Acceptance. When something bad happens—whether an existential crisis or a personal tragedy—the first step is to accept that it has happened. Unlike prior crises, such as hurricanes, earthquakes, or other disasters, this crisis is not regionalized. Everyone is a participant. Once you accept the crisis for what it is, you can start to take the necessary steps to deal with it.
